Output 3abd5df4b61767c31a4106256ee6eef9a998c5fb4ce2e35d7d003774df78a4f3:758

value
11828
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 efb92485f8e2eec001aeef0b6542f4cb98a0cd764c902c88c9a46241727820f5
address
bc1pa7ujfp0cuthvqqdwau9k2sh5ewv2pntkfjgzezxf533yzuncyr6szrqhsl
transaction
3abd5df4b61767c31a4106256ee6eef9a998c5fb4ce2e35d7d003774df78a4f3